Chelsea & Arsenal to battle for English striker?

Chelsea and Arsenal could go head-to-head to sign Brentford striker Ivan Toney during the summer transfer window.
The Englishman had a tremendous recent campaign with the Bees, contributing 20 goals in the Premier League.
However, he was handed an eight-month ban by FA right before the season concluded due to his betting breaches.
Toney will be allowed to play again in January and it appears he could be on his way out of Brentford, as per Romano.
Chelsea and Arsenal are keeping tabs on him, but there are also other clubs that could enter the race for his signature.
Romano claims that Brentford are aware of the player's desire to move on from the club at some point in 2024.
It could happen in either January or next summer, but the Bees are expected to demand at least £60m to sell him.
Earlier this year, Toney said that Arsenal are one of his favourite clubs. The Gunners could have the edge in the race.
